How atrocious is the comedy “Everybody Wants to Be Italian”? Let me count the ways. There’s the punishingly jaunty ethnic soundtrack (“Funiculì, Funiculà,” la la la) and the regressive gender stereotypes. Then there’s the heroine whose lofty dating standards demand a partner who’s “a step up” from her vibrator, and the hero who — cognitively, at least — rates several rungs lower. And if you’re still not persuaded to just rent “Moonstruck” and be done with it, ponder this: assuming the title was ever correct, it won’t be by the time you exit the theater. [...]
